A house on the back side of Big Ridge caught fire Sunday morning after the owner said he heard an explosion.

The Chattanooga Fire Department was dispatched to a residential house fire at 1905 Summerbreeze Lane at 9:49 a.m.

Reports coming into Hamilton County 911 were advising that the house was burning down. Squad 19 from Hixson Station 19 arrived on the scene to a two-story house with smoke and flames coming from a basement utility garage at the rear of the house.

Chattanooga Fire Department Stations 16, 22, 6, also were on scene. Battalion Chief Chris Warren called for an additional fire engine from Station 10 due to the size of the structure.

An aggressive fire attack was deployed and the fire was extinguished at 10:14 a.m. The additional fire response from Station 10 was cancelled.

There was fire, smoke and water damage confined to the basement. There were no injuries reported.

The homeowner stated that he heard an explosion that rocked his house, went to the basement and discovered the fire, then called 911.

The Chattanooga Police Department and Hamilton County EMS and EPB were on the scene to assist.
